This was my first and I really enjoyed the weekend. The BBQ on Friday was a nice kickoff, spent Saturday night with other forum members on 6th street and ran into guys I haven't seen in years.
I had seats in the Honda section and that included one lap on the track. That was fun.
I ate a big breakfast every morning and 2 bottles of water kept me happy until evening.
Something that I found amazing about the weekend.
With the thousands of sport, sport/touring bikes in Austin for the race I did not see one single burnout, wheelie, or stunt. I never even saw a bike pulled over by the police. It was a great crowd to be a part of.
